Transaction 63dbafc1033024d81e49b98ae070169c17f2a531b5313054d5d1ecd5dc91082f

1 Input
2 Outputs
  • 63dbafc1033024d81e49b98ae070169c17f2a531b5313054d5d1ecd5dc91082f:0
  • value  1121200
    address  3CCdwEdWcLWhopynfvVRbBatq4smNbURdm
  • 63dbafc1033024d81e49b98ae070169c17f2a531b5313054d5d1ecd5dc91082f:1
  • value  1163601804
    address  bc1q8mhvgjx57vd0snlljr8un6pes27y3qhv4j39jh